FORT WORTH, Texas - In terms of 1.5-mile, intermediate tracks, few come tougher than Texas Motor Speedway.
With its two sets of corners built differently from one another, a unique challenge is presented to the NASCAR Cup Series field in the Lone Star State.
So, solid starting spots are at a premium. And they were on the line on Saturday.
Both William Byron and Kyle Larson will start in the top five for Hendrick Motorsports. Byron turned in the session's second-best lap at 28.189 seconds while Larson was fourth best at 28.21. Alex Bowman just missed a top-10 spot and will roll off 11th after a lap of 28.284. Chase Elliott rounded out the group and will start 29th.
"I felt like I hit (turns) one and two pretty good, I was just right on the edge of being two tight and then (turns) three and four were wide open," Byron said. "Just appreciate all the guys on the 24. They did a great job today. We've been good on the mile-and-a-halfs, obviously, just trying to dial in our race balance and feel like we're really close."

Hendrick Motorsports is the standard bearer in most statistical categories at the quad oval, leading in wins (12), poles (eight), top fives (45), top 10s (80) and laps led (3,150). The team has combined to win three of the last four races at Texas with Larson winning in 2021, Byron in 2023 and Elliott last year. Larson also went to victory lane in the All-Star Race, held at Texas Motor Speedway in 2021.
Saturday racing at Texas Motor Speedway was slated to continue with the NASCAR Xfinity Series race at 2 p.m. Corey Day will make his second start of the season in the No. 17 HendrickCars.com Chevrolet and will roll off 33rd after qualifying was scrapped due to rain on Friday afternoon. Larson will fill in for the injured Connor Zilisch in the No. 88 JR Motorsports Chevrolet.
Sunday's Cup Series main event is scheduled for a 3:30 p.m. green flag and will air on FS1.
